Presented is an original cabinet photograph of Hall of Fame pitcher Joe McGinnity, taken by renowned Boston photographer Carl Horner. Certified by PSA/DNA as a Type I original, this formal studio portrait features McGinnity in his New York Giants uniform, captured during the height of his storied Major League career. The photo mount bears Horner’s distinctive studio credit, reading “Horner-Jordan Co./250 Huntington Ave. Boston/Opp. Symphony Hall” along the base. Although undated, PSA/DNA has attributed the image to the period circa 1902–1904.

This iconic photograph is instantly recognizable to collectors, as it served as the source image for several classic early 20th-century baseball issues, including McGinnity’s 1902–1911 W600 Sporting Life Cabinet card (Type 3), the 1904 Allegheny Card Company card, the 1905 PC782 Rotograph postcard, the 1906 Fan Craze card, and the 1908 PC760 Rose Company postcard. The reverse of the mount features McGinnity’s name along with several editorial notations.

As one of the premier baseball photographers of the era, Carl Horner captured many of the sport’s early legends. His Boston studio’s proximity to both American and National League clubs allowed him to photograph nearly every Major League player of the early 1900s, making his works highly sought after among collectors.

The photograph itself exhibits exceptional clarity and tonal depth, grading Excellent overall, with the mount showing minor tack holes along the right edge and a small spot of soiling near the base.

Original images used in the creation of trading cards—especially those depicting Hall of Famers from early sets—have become increasingly desirable among advanced collectors. This particular example stands out not only for its remarkable preservation and direct connection to multiple vintage card issues but also for featuring Joe “Iron Man” McGinnity, one of the most celebrated pitchers of baseball’s formative years.

Accompanied by a full Letter of Authenticity (LOA) from PSA/DNA.
